It’s time for another faceoff between VPN providers, and this battle will feature Private Internet Access (PIA) and TorGuard. The provider also provides excellent encryption, a generous number of simultaneous connections and BitTorrent support. If you’re in search of a VPN provider that offers above-average global server coverage, streaming service access and customer support, you’ll find TorGuard to be an attractive option among VPN providers. The provider offers app support for all of the major computing platforms, but it lacks wide-ranging global server coverage. If you’re looking for a value-priced Virtual Private Network (VPN) provider that offers fast connection speeds, top-notch privacy protections and P2P file sharing support, you’ll find Private Internet Access (PIA) to be an attractive option.
